I was at a client during the Pitt game. The whole office (about a dozen people) stopped what they were doing and we all went into the conference room to watch the final minute. Everyone went crazy after he hit the shot.

That was a noon weekday game in the quarterfinal round. That's how special the old Big East was. You got #1 vs #19 nationally in the friggin quaterfinals, before things even got real in the BET.

Pitt fans were always the worst of the old BE, though I have to hand it to them, they travel well.

I remember that during the 2004 BET championship game, UConn fell behind by double digits in the 2nd half, and a crazy UConn fan made a $200 bet with a Pitt fan that UConn would win. The whole section knew. And a neutral G'Town fan was charged with holding the cash. That Pitt fan was roasted after UConn came back and won.
